ekaterra is the biggest tea business in the world, with world class purpose driven brands such as Lipton, PG tips and Pukka. eka stands for unity and one purpose while terra stands for earth and nature. As ekaterra we are united in one purpose: growing a world of wellbeing through the regenerative power of plants. Present in more than 100 countries, ekaterra generated revenues of €2 billion in 2019, whilst part of Unilever. With 11 production factories in four continents and tea growing estates in three countries, ekaterra is a profitable and growing business offering a world of wellbeing with the regenerative power of plants to hundreds of millions of consumers. Recently Unilever announced that it had agreed to sell ekaterra to CVC Capital Partners Fund VIII.
